Rig Specs
Corsair Graphite 780T White Full Tower Case
Seasonic 1050W 80 Plus Platinum Power Supply + White Cable Mod Set.
ASUS X99 Deluxe
Intel Core i7 5930K
Fractal Kelvin S36 Cooler
ASUS GeForce GTX 980 Strix DirectCU II 4GB x 2 in SLI
Kingston HyperX Predator 16GB 3000MHz
Samsung 850 Pro Series 512GB SSD
Samsung 850 Evo Series 1TB SSD
I experiencing some issues with the new build and honestly have no idea what it is causing it.
Main issue is the pc after working perfectly after full shutdown when I try to switch it on sometimes will not power up unless I switch of the mains supply by the socket on the walls for a few minutes giving it enough time to be clear of any power that may be remaining in the pc then turn back on and power up then works fine, its very annoying!
I have tried clearing the cmos and reset everything to defaults doesn't fix the problem, I have remove the graphics cards and reinstalled them and also the same with the memory even pulled out the cpu and reinstalled.
On another note not sure if it would be related but if I enable the XMP profiles system seems stable then crashes randomly with random BSOD's, I though the XMP profiles would work without issues.
